Have you ever wondered how Dragons might exist? How they could fly, how they might live and think, how they could breathe flame? Few other non-extant creatures exert such a powerful influence over many so cultures, and their languages and perceptions, around the world. In some ways, they represent the pinnacle of our desires - the absolutes of beauty, freedom, flight, power, magic, and wealth. Combining the might and power of western myths and the mystery and magic of eastern legends, the Dragons that exist in the world of Kuln are different from any you have seen before. This is a short and detailed look into their anatomy, intellect, and how they might really work, in excerpts from the notes of Aldwyn Varelin - a pre-eminent scholar in Anaria - during his journeys in The Serpent Calls, Book One of the Chaoswar Trilogy.
